| Activity | It is reported that ubiquitin-specific peptidase 18 (as UBP43) efficiently hydrolyses only ISG15 fusion proteins, including native ISG15 conjugates linked via isopeptide bonds (<%Malakhov %etal, 2002[20040908A033]%>). | ||
| Activity status | human: putative mouse: putative | ||
| Knockout | The phenotype of ubiquitin-specific peptidase 18 knockout mice includes shortened life span, hypersensitivity to interferon and neuronal damage (Tokarz et al., 2004). However, the phenotypic alterations of the knockout mice are not caused by lack of ISG15 deconjugation as at one time proposed (Knobeloch et al., 2005). | ||
